Unveiling Total Organic Carbon Content

A TOC analyzer serves as a powerful tool for determining the total organic carbon content within a sample. This procedure get more info utilizes sophisticated detectors to faithfully measure the amount of carbon-based material present. TOC analyzers play a crucial role in diverse fields such as environmental monitoring, water processing, food safety, and industrial process control.

The output obtained from a TOC analyzer offer crucial information about the nature of a sample. This understanding is essential for assessing various parameters such as water quality, soil fertility, and discharge treatment efficiency.

Applications of TOC Analyzers Across Industries

TOC analyzers possess a wide spectrum of purposes across diverse industries. In the manufacturing sector, they measure total organic carbon content in raw materials, goods, and wastewater. The beverage industry utilizes TOC analyzers to monitor contamination levels in water, soil, and ingredients. In environmental analysis, these analyzers assist in measuring the organic carbon content of water samples, soil streams, and air. Furthermore, TOC analyzers find purposes in research laboratories for investigating various organic compounds and reactions.
